Affirm is reinventing credit to make it more honest and friendly, giving consumers the flexibility to buy now and pay later without any hidden fees or compounding interest. Affirm proudly includes Returnly.
At Affirm, our compliance program activities include advisory, training, independent testing & monitoring, reporting, and oversight. As the second line of defense, we proactively partner with the business to support new products, markets, and initiatives.
We're seeking a Senior Director of International Compliance to lead an international team of compliance professionals in Canada, Australia and other markets. This remote US-based role will report to the VP, Consumer Compliance / Head of Global Compliance and will work cross-functionally across the company.
In this role, you will be responsible for compliance programs in multiple geographic markets, collaborate on new products and services, and scope the regulatory landscape in new geographic markets. The role will also lead compliance due diligence efforts for M&A activity both domestically and internationally.
